A TWIC card is the Transportation Worker Identification Credential. It is required by the Maritime Transportation Security Act for anyone who needs access to secure areas in the nation’s maritime facilities. CDL drivers who pick up from and deliver cargo to ports will need a TWIC card. Any time a trucker needs to access secure areas …All Ports within the United States require both a TWIC Card and a Port ID. Individuals who have lost their TWIC card can get a replacement card online or by calling 855-347-8371 Monday through Friday, 8 a.m. to 10 p.m. EST. If the applicant pays by check or money order, they’ll need to order the replacement card at their nearest enrollment center. Most applicants without disqualifying ...TWIC® The Transportation Worker Identification Credential, also known as TWIC®, is a tamper- and counterfeit-resistant biometric smart card credential. The card is aligned with government standards for federal employee, service member, and contractor smart card credentials contained in Federal Information Processing Standards Publication 201-1.
